
With an increased attendance, the team from Media in Africa Group (MIAG) were pleased to host the DAS CPD event in Nelspruit/ Mbombela.
The interactive agenda of speakers with time for questions from the delegates was informative and engaging. Sponsored exhibits gave the architects and designers the opportunity to learn about new products and services from industry leaders across the built environment.
Des Schnetler, executive chair of the Thermal Insulation Products and Systems Association South Africa (TIPSASA) started the day with a comparison between SANS 10400-XA, and reality.
Interim president of SAIA Mpumalanga, Nicholas Els delivered an update on what the local chapter of the institute are undertaking, and the benefits of membership.
Returning to the DAS stage, Asher Marcus from Hubo Studio delved into his topic, “Spaces as visionary as you are” referencing the iconic Redhill ELC project.
Another returning speaker, Riaan Hollenbach of The Grey Whippet, shared his Pretoria presentation with the gathering of Lowveld colleagues. His topic, “Not your usual client’ detailed his journey with an owner/ builder as a client.
Callie can der Merwe discussed COOOP’s groundbreaking envirohacking concept, and design ethos, in a video presentation from Australia.
Sponsors, Willem Grove from Coverland, and Candice Williams and TJ from Brits Nonwoven also presented to the delegates on the day.
